The University of Houston is a public research university in Houston, Texas, and the flagship institution of the University of Houston System.

Established in 1974, Learning Tree International is a leading provider of IT and management training to business and government organizations worldwide. In addition, Learning Tree provides IT Workforce Optimization Solutions — a modern approach that improves the adoption of skills, and accelerates the implementation of technical and business processes required to improve IT service delivery. To support both business and government organizations in their workforce optimization efforts, Learning Tree develops structured learning paths prior to training, and provides implementation services that extend the value of training long after a training event has concluded. These custom services include: needs assessments, skill gaps analyses, blended learning solutions, and project acceleration and process implementation workshops. Over 2.5 million IT professionals have enhanced their knowledge, skills, and abilities from Learning Tree`s hands-on, instructor-led training by accessing a broad library of proprietary and partner course content on topics including: web development, cyber security, program and project management, Agile and best practice adoption, operating systems, database administration and programming, networking, cloud computing, big data, software design and development, business intelligence, activity-based intelligence, leadership, management and business skills, and more.
